In 2019-2020, 14,096 people earned their degree in sports kinesiology and physical education/fitness general, making the major the 55th most popular in the United States.

Across Louisiana, there were 85 sports kinesiology and physical education/fitness general graduates with average earnings and debt of $0 and $0 respectively. At the master’s degree level specifically, there were 16 sports kinesiology and physical education/fitness general graduates with average earnings and debt of $53,288 and $46,372 respectively.

You’ll be in good company if you decide to attend Northwestern State University of Louisiana. It ranked #1 on our 2022 Best Vallue Physical Education Schools for a Master’s in Louisiana For Those Making Over $110k list. Natchitoches, Louisiana is the setting for this fairly large institution of higher learning. The public school handed out masters’s phys ed degrees to 16 students in 2019-2020.

In addition to being on our louisiana master’s degree physical education students whose families make more than $110k list, NSU has also earned the #1 rank in our “Best Sports Kinesiology and Physical Education/Fitness General Master’s Degree Schools in Louisiana” ranking. Average graduate tuition and fees at NSU are $20,402, but some majors have different tuition rates.
